On the Change of Distance Energy of Complete Bipartite Graph due to Edge Deletion
Shaowei Sun,
Ziyan Wan and
Shaofang Hong
Journal of Mathematics, 2021, vol. 2021, 1-3
Abstract:
The distance energy of a graph is defined as the sum of absolute values of distance eigenvalues of the graph. The distance energy of a graph plays an important role in many fields. By constructing a new polynomial, we transform a problem on the sum of the absolute values of the roots of a quadratic polynomial into a problem on the largest root of a cubic polynomial. Hence, we give a new and shorter proof on the change of distance energy of a complete bipartite graph due to edge deletion, which was given by Varghese et al.
